ERP and ICBT for OCD: what’s the difference?
Exposure and Response Prevention (ERP or ExRP) has long been considered the ‘gold standard’ of treatment for obsessive-compulsive disorder (OCD). However, Inference-based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(ICBT) has a growing amount of research supporting its effectiveness for treating OCD as well. But what’s the difference? the grief of leaving
Deciding to leave a faith community can really feel like you’re pulling the rug out from under yourself. It can cause grief, a sense of loss – of the community, and also part of your identity.
